CHARITABLE AID BOARD. THIS DAY.
The Hospital and Charitable Aid Board met to-day. Present: Messrs. Kichmond (chairman), Bayly, J. Elliot, and T. Elliot. Funds. — The following letter from the Premier's office was read : — I have the honor to acknowledge the receipt of ycur letter of the 16th inatant, stating that the Board has levied contributions on the local authorities in the district, and that in accordance with their promise the Government will advance money to enable the Board to carry on until the contributions come in. In reply I am directed to express regret that the Government are unable to comply with your request, as since my letter of the 12th of November was written, the audit officers have decliced to sanction the payment of any subsidies in advance. Several other Boards in the same position aro making arrangements locally for temporary advances, the Government understand, an! I am to suggest that the mine course might be followed by your Board. — The Hospital Board, under these circumstances, have represented to the local bodies the necessity for prompt payment of the subsidies. New Plymouth Hospital. — The Board j went fully into matters connected with the New Plymouth Hospital. The subjects of discussion were principally accounts and other detail matters.
